It provides accurate resistance ratios for voltage division, reference voltage generation, and signal conditioning, ensuring precise measurement of voltage, current, and resistance.
Temperature variations can cause resistance drift. Precision networks use low-temperature-coefficient materials and designs to minimize this effect, maintaining accuracy across operating ranges.
